Light device - OK for light use
Gardenline 20V Cordless Line Trimmer (Jan 2017, Oct 2017, Oct 2018, Oct 2022)Recently bought this line trimmer with the hope I could move away from my petrol units.
I have used it a few times, but not enough to have to refill the line.
Positives:
Light; Quiet; easy start/stop [no need to pull starter cord]; easy to store; easy to charge without need to store petrol.
Negatives:
Overall a bit short from me - i felt i had to almost stand immediately onto of the weeds to cut them (I'm ~ 179 cm tall).
I felt it struggled when dealing with tall or thick grass.
Struggled when dealing with thick ground coverings - didn't provide a clean edge.
May become a bit expensive when factoring a charger & battery (say extra $50-80)
... Read more In conclusion This may be suitable if you only have a very small yard; yet for the perceived convenience you may be better to use hedge cutters or getting a corded unit.

where to get part for gardenline wiper sniper
My gardenline 20v snipper is wearing out at the point of the tap to feed line. Spring is visible and may protrude . Can any spool replacement be obtained? 5 year warranty not expired.
Ebay has a brilliant head using an allen key to secure the 1 or 2 cord peices you choose to use.
ONLY glitch is you need to have a left hand thread bolt to fit the new head with, which in most cases came with the original purchase. I can use 3mm+ cord which lasts the whole yard :-)
I melted plastic over the bump knobs and hand pull line out as required. The spring is held in place by the mend. So far so good. Thanks
